Duplicated determinations resulted in the following ranges: -52.6 °C to -40.2 °C and -52.5 °C to -40.0 °C, mean value was reported -52.6 °C to -40.1 °C +/-0.2 °C.

The validity criterion "difference between duplicate determinations" was met. The test item Pentaerytritoltetrakis (3 -mercaptopropionate) (THIOCURE PETMP) showed a melting range, no melting point. As the test item is per definition a monoconstituent substance with a significant impurity, this is considered as normal. No observations were made which might cause doubts on the validity of the study outcome. Therefore, the result of the study is considered valid.

Conclusions:
The melting range of the test substance Pentaerytritoltetrakis (3-mercaptopropionate) (THIOCURE PETMP) has been deternined to be -52.6 to -40.1 °C +/- 0.2°C.
Executive summary:

The test material Pentaerytritoltetrakis (3-mercaptopropionate) (THIOCURE PETMP) has been determined to have a melting range of -52.6 to -40.1 °C +/- 0.2°C by using capillary method with an aluminium block, according to 102 OECD Guideline as of 27. July 1995 "Melting Point/Melting Range" for testing of chemicals and EU-Method A.1, as of 31. July 1992, "Melting/Freezing Temperature".
